#2AB27E Color
#2AB27E is rgb(42, 178, 126) in RGB, hsl(157, 62%, 43%) in HSL, and about cmyk(76%, 0%, 29%, 30%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Green (Crayola) (#1CAC78), below the threshold most people can see at ΔE 2.29.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#2AB27E Channel Values
How #2AB27E bre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 42 · G 178 · B 126 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 157° · S 62% · L 43%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 157° · S 76% · V 70%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 76% · M 0% · Y 29% · K 30%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.7:1 vs white · 7.77: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#2AB27E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#2AB27E?
#2AB27E is a mid-tone green — rgb(42, 178, 126) in RGB and hsl(157, 62%, 43%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Green (Crayola) (#1CAC78), which is below the threshold most people can see at a CIE76 distance of 2.29.
What is the RGB value of #2AB27E?
#2AB27E is rgb(42, 178, 126) — red 42, green 178, and blue 126 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#2AB27E?
#2AB27E converts to approximately cmyk(76%, 0%, 29%, 30%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#2AB27E be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#2AB27E scores 2.7:1 against white and 7.77: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#2AB27E as a CSS color keyword?
No. #2AB27E is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umseagreen (#3CB371) at a CIE76 distance of 7.7,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
